Surrey summers have gotten noticeably hotter over the last decade. Heat domes in 2021, 2022, and 2023 pushed temperatures past 40°C in parts of the Lower Mainland — far beyond what homes without AC were designed to handle. If you're still relying on a fan or a window unit, a properly installed central AC or ductless system changes your summers entirely.

We install all AC systems with a Manual J load calculation — the proper engineering method for sizing cooling equipment to your home's actual cooling demand. An oversized AC unit cools too quickly without removing humidity, leaving your home clammy and running up energy bills. Proper sizing ensures efficient, comfortable cooling.

AC Installation Options for Surrey Homes

Central Air Conditioning Pairs with your existing gas furnace and ductwork. A single outdoor condenser unit and coil in your air handler cools the whole home through existing vents. Most cost-effective for ducted homes.
Ductless Mini-Split (Single Zone) No ductwork required. One outdoor unit, one wall-mounted indoor head. Ideal for Surrey homes without ducts, suites, or additions. Installed in 3–5 hours.
Multi-Zone Ductless One outdoor unit powering 2–5 indoor heads in different rooms. Cool your whole home without ductwork. Excellent for Surrey townhomes and older homes.
Heat Pump (Cooling + Heating) A heat pump installs the same as central AC but also heats in winter — replacing your gas furnace. With CleanBC rebates up to $6,000+, often comparable net cost to AC alone.

Why Sizing Matters More Than Brand

The biggest mistake Surrey homeowners make when buying AC is choosing a brand before choosing a size. A 5-ton unit in a home that needs 3 tons will short-cycle constantly, fail to dehumidify, and wear out the compressor within a few years. Our in-home sizing assessment takes 30–40 minutes and gives us the exact cooling load — down to BTU/hr — before we recommend any equipment.

Consider a heat pump instead: If you're installing AC in Surrey and your furnace is over 12 years old, a heat pump often makes more financial sense than a new AC unit alone. A heat pump provides both cooling and heating, qualifies for CleanBC rebates of $3,000–$6,000+, and typically costs less than a new AC + furnace when rebates are factored in. How much does AC installation cost in Surrey? +
Central AC installation in Surrey typically costs $3,500–$6,500 installed, depending on system size and ductwork condition. Ductless mini-split installation runs $3,000–$5,500 for a single-zone system. Multi-zone ductless systems covering 2–4 areas are $6,000–$12,000. How long does AC installation take in Surrey? +
A standard central AC installation on an existing forced-air system takes 4–6 hours. Ductless mini-split installation is typically 3–5 hours for a single zone. We complete most installations in one day.
Should I get central AC or a ductless mini-split in Surrey? +
If your home already has a gas furnace with ductwork in good condition, central AC is usually most cost-effective. If your home has no ductwork, or you want to cool an addition or suite, a ductless mini-split is the better option. If you're open to replacing your furnace at the same time, a heat pump covers both heating and cooling — and CleanBC rebates of $3,000–$6,000 make it very competitive.
Do I need a permit for AC installation in Surrey? +
A permit is required for central AC installation in Surrey where refrigerant lines and electrical work are involved. For ductless mini-splits, an electrical permit is required for the dedicated circuit. We handle all permitting as part of the installation — it's included in your quote.
